As a participant in the ongoing rub and sauce swap I would have loved to send my trading partner my personal dry rub, mop and finishing sauce. My stuff is pretty darn good and I would have liked to get some feedback outside of my area. I am concerned with properly preserving and bottling the liquid products. Anyone out there with suggestions?
 
Shelf stable sauces require a certain acidity. Spicewine is knowledgable in this area. Shoot him a PM.
